linux目录和Windows目录对比

我们应该知道 Windows 有一个默认的安装目录专门用来安装软件。Linux 的软件安装目录也应该是有讲究的,遵循这一点,对后期的管理和维护也是有帮助的。

/usr系统级的目录,可以理解为 C:/Windows/, /usr/lib可理解为C:/Windows/System32 。

/usr/local 用户级的程序目录,可以理解为 C:/Progrem Files/。用户自己编译的软件默认会安装到这个目录下。

/opt 用户级的程序目录,可以理解为 D:/Software , opt 有可选的意思,这里可以用于放置第三方大型软件(或游戏),当你不需要时,直接rm -rf掉即可。

在硬盘容量不够时,也可将/opt 单独挂载到其他磁盘上使用。

源码一般放在usr里面(一般自动下载的软件都安装在usr里面)

usr是Unix System Resource,即Unix系统资源的缩写

/usr/src 系统级的源码目录。

/usr/local/src 用户级的源码目录。

/usr/local这里主要存放那些手动安装的软件,即不是通过“新立得”或apt-get安装的软件。它和/usr目录具有相类似的目录结构。

/usr 这里主要存放“新立得”或apt-get安装的软件

/opt

这里主要存放那些可选的程序。你想尝试最新的firefox测试版吗?那就装到/opt目录下吧,这样,当你尝试完,想删掉firefox的时候,你就可 以直接删除它,而不影响系统其他任何设置。安装到/opt目录下的程序,它所有的数据、库文件等等都是放在同个目录下面。

举个例子:刚才装的测试版firefox,就可以装到/opt/firefox_beta目录下,/opt/firefox_beta目录下面就包含了运 行firefox所需要的所有文件、库、数据等等。要删除firefox的时候,你只需删除/opt/firefox_beta目录即可,非常简单。

Windows 和 Linux 目录对应关系

1、C:\Windows   与  /root

C:\Windows 目录是 windows 最高权限账户 administrator 所对应的目录

/root 目录是 linux 最高权限账户 root 所对应的目录

2、C:\Users    与     /home

C:\Users 目录是 windows 一般账户所在目录

/home 目录是 linux 一般账户所在目录

软件的 用户级 配置文件就在该一般账户所对应的目录下

3、C:\ProgramData     与     /etc

C:\ProgramData 目录是 windows 系统中软件所对应的 系统级 配置文件所对应的目录

/etc 目录是 linux 系统中软件所对应的 系统级 配置文件所对应的目录

4、C:\Program Files(C:\Program Files (x86))    与    /usr

C:\Program Files(C:\Program Files (x86)) 目录是 windows 系统下安装软件时的默认安装路径

/usr 目录是 linux 系统下安装软件时的默认安装路径

原文链接:

https://www.w3h5.com/post/336.html

https://blog.csdn.net/u012219371/article/details/100086832

linux目录对应windows,linux目录和Windows目录对比相关推荐

  1. 共享windows目录给vm linux,将windows中的文件夹共享给Linux虚拟机

    按正常步骤安装Linux 安装完成后在Linux系统中安装vmware-tools工具. 选择"编辑虚拟机设置" 4.选择"选项"然后点击"共享文件夹 ...

  2. linux php目录是否存在,PHP判断文件或者目录是否可写,兼容windows/linux系统

    在PHP中,可用is_writable()函数来判断一个 文件/目录 是否可写,用是否可生成文件的方式判断目录是否可写:网上的一些代码大多数能判断linux系统,但windows服务器下判断不准确. ...

  3. window挂载到linux服务器上,Windows服务器目录挂载到linux服务器

    把Windows服务器172.17.43.56(内网地址)的目录mount到CentOS服务器172.17.43.57(内网地址)的目录上. #linux服务器的挂载状态[root@iZ2zeoecj ...

  4. linux整个文件夹下全部文件的属性,C/C++遍历目录下的所有文件(Windows/Linux篇,超详细)...

    前面的一篇文章我们讲了用Windows API遍历一个目录下的所有文件,这次我们讲用一种Windows/Linux通用的方法遍历一个目录下的所有文件. Windows/Linux的IDE都会提供一个头 ...

  5. windows 传输目录文件到linux pscp: xxx: not a regular file

    windows 传输目录文件到linux 报错 pscp: xxx: not a regular file 解决方案 1:所传输的目标目录可能没权限: chmod 777 2: 在使用pscp时加上- ...

  6. windows,linux下SVN实现自动更新WEB目录

    http://www.bestphper.cn/article-132.html 通过SVN进行版本库管理,每次提交后,都要在SVN服务器更新最新上传的版本到WEB目录进行同步.操作比较烦琐,而且效率 ...

  7. windows linux目录相互同步,使用cwRsync在Windows的目录之间增量同步文件

    rsync 是 Linux 上的一款文件同步工具,他可以以其特有的算法,对两个目录进行本机或跨机器同步. 下载安装 这款十分好用的工具,在 Windows 也可以使用,叫做 cwRsync ,首先需要 ...

  8. Windows 系统文件夹目录挂载到 Linux服务器中

    在Windows系统文件上传到Linux服务器时有时候很麻烦,因为Linux无界面的系统不像Windows系统一样,可以直接复制粘贴,下面方法可以解决Windows系统文件拷贝到Linux服务器. 1 ...

  9. Linux和Windows共享文件夹:/mnt目录下没有/hgfs的解决办法

    一.问题 linux与windows之间设立共享文件夹,但在/mnt文件夹下没有hgfs文件夹. 二.解决办法 步骤: 1.打开terminal:输入:sudo apt-get install ope ...

最新文章

  1. 纯!干!货!2019年19个Docker面试问题和解答!一线大厂必看!
  2. 为什么苹果 M1 芯片如此之快?
  3. OpenGL ES着色器语言之语句和结构体(官方文档第六章)内建变量(官方文档第七、八章)...
  4. 4.9 总结-深度学习第一课《神经网络与深度学习》-Stanford吴恩达教授
  5. 【多线程高并发】深入浅出volatile关键字
  6. Go语言很好很强大,但我有几个问题想吐槽
  7. office 2010中自带的 微软拼音输入法2010卸载
  8. Halcon基本例程(二)
  9. Win能ping通win7,但是无法访问共享的解决方法
  10. Java compiler level does not match the version of the installed Java project facet.问题
  11. matlab画圆的命令_matlab画矩形和matlab画圆
  12. Hadoop大数据环境搭建保姆级教程(完整版)
  13. python身份证号码计算年龄
  14. 分解动力学类有哪些最新发表的毕业论文呢?
  15. xbox手柄适配器驱动_用于Windows的Xbox 360控制器无线接收器适配器
  16. 微信 小程序 APP 渗透测试方案
  17. SpringBoot Mongo 动态分表 动态修改表名
  18. 广州大学机器学习与数据挖掘实验三
  19. IMU使用入门——WT901CM
  20. jquery(文本框添加符号)

热门文章

  1. 北大青鸟深圳嘉华分享MySQL用户管理
  2. 面试官:抽象工厂模式是什么?
  3. Hive 优化--SQL执行顺序、Hive参数、数据倾斜 、小文件优化
  4. 游戏场景和关卡怎么设计
  5. 写作系列之: UAV领域概述的参考文献集合
  6. 最小二乘法直线拟合计算
  7. 【算法竞赛学习笔记】离散对数与BSGS-数学提升计划
  8. 海思Hi3798MV310芯片处理器参数介绍
  9. Kali社会工程学套件上的二维码攻击工具
  10. PageOffice在线打开office文件添加盖章没反应